Skids

Skids

Scottish punk rock band

Skids are a Scottish punk rock and new wave band, formed in Dunfermline, Fife, in 1977 by Stuart Adamson (guitar, keyboards, percussion), Richard Jobson (vocals, guitar), Bill Simpson (bass guitar), and Tom Kellichan (drums). They are best known for their 1979 hit single "Into the Valley" and the album "Scared to Dance," which was their debut studio album. The band's music combined punk rock with elements of post-punk and new wave.
